Post by Nevada Hoya on Nov 3, 2014 16:30:03 GMT -5
Unbelievable run by the women as they got their 7 scorers all in the top 10; that must be a record for depth. Also, they ran two others, and they got in the top 20. Hoping for good things at nationals.
1 1 57 Katrina Coogan SR Georgetown 20:31.0 5:31 2 2 113 Catarina Rocha SO Providence 20:40.0 5:34 3 3 65 Haley Pierce SO Georgetown 20:52.7 5:37 4 4 62 Samantha Nadel JR Georgetown 20:56.5 5:38 5 5 60 Andrea Keklak JR Georgetown 20:58.4 5:39 6 6 63 Hannah Neczypor SR Georgetown 20:59.0 5:39 7 7 6 Mara Olson SR Butler 20:59.1 5:39 8 8 66 Kelsey Smith JR Georgetown 21:01.8 5:40 9 9 58 Sarah Cotton SO Georgetown 21:06.9 5:41 10 10 110 Katie Lembo FR Providence 21:10.9 5:42 11 11 30 Courtney Sawle SR Creighton 21:14.5 5:43 12 12 162 Siofra Cleirigh Buttne FR Villanova 21:17.5 5:44 13 13 11 Colleen Weatherford SO Butler 21:24.3 5:46 14 14 111 Lauren Mullins JR Providence 21:25.5 5:46 15 59 Autumn Eastman FR Georgetown 21:28.7 5:47 16 15 107 Brianna Ilarda FR Providence 21:32.0 5:48 17 16 169 Stephanie Schappert SR Villanova 21:34.1 5:48 18 17 12 Lauren Wood SO Butler 21:37.2 5:49 19 61 Annamarie Maag SR Georgetown 21:46.3 5:52 20 18 83 Kellie Greenwood JR Marquette 21:47.5 5:52

Post by Nevada Hoya on Nov 3, 2014 16:32:45 GMT -5
While not doing so well as the women, the men also displayed their depth, as the Hoyas placed 10 runners in the top 27 to take 2nd to Nova.
1 1 180 Patrick Tiernan SO Villanova 23:45.8 4:47 2 2 177 Sam McEntee SR Villanova 23:51.9 4:49 3 3 183 Jordan Williamsz JR Villanova 23:52.1 4:49 4 4 21 Erik Peterson JR Butler 23:52.6 4:49 5 5 73 Jonathan Green FR Georgetown 23:52.7 4:49 6 6 174 Robert Denault JR Villanova 23:55.0 4:49 7 7 71 Darren Fahy SO Georgetown 23:55.8 4:49 8 8 117 Benjamin Connor SR Providence 23:59.9 4:50 9 9 126 Shane Quinn SR Providence 24:01.6 4:51 10 10 70 Scott Carpenter SO Georgetown 24:03.3 4:51 11 11 172 Brian Basili SR Villanova 24:03.6 4:51 12 12 182 Harry Warnick SO Villanova 24:16.7 4:54 13 13 124 Julian Oakley SO Providence 24:19.7 4:54 14 14 69 Ahmed Bile SO Georgetown 24:22.3 4:55 15 15 72 Ryan Gil SO Georgetown 24:24.3 4:55 16 16 121 Brian Doyle SR Providence 24:28.8 4:56 17 17 79 John Murray SR Georgetown 24:32.3 4:57 18 18 120 Harvey Dixon JR Providence 24:36.0 4:57 19 19 76 Brian King SR Georgetown 24:36.6 4:58 20 20 119 Trevor Crawley SO Providence 24:37.4 4:58 21 21 173 Kevin Corbusier SO Villanova 24:38.0 4:58 22 74 Matt Howard SR Georgetown 24:38.7 4:58 23 22 122 Aaron Hanlon FR Providence 24:40.6 4:58 24 116 Hugh Armstrong SO Providence 24:43.4 4:59 25 123 Liam Hillery SR Providence 24:48.4 5:00 26 77 Collin Leibold JR Georgetown 24:48.5 5:00 27 75 Stephen Kersh SR Georgetown 24:49.1 5:00
